ISL Soccer League: Union, Arsenal Win

ISL Soccer League: Union, Arsenal Win

Last night [June 28], the Union dispensed of the Royal 10-3 and the Arsenal beat up on the Kings 9-3 at National Stadium. The Union moved to 2-1 on the year while the Royal drop to 0-3. Police: 18 Accidents Reported In 24 Hours

In the 24 hour span between Monday and Tuesday morning, there were 18 road accidents reported to the Police. Women’s Football Team Announced

The Bermuda Football Association announced the Women’s Football Team for the preliminary competition CONCACAF Caribbean Zone – Round 1 of Group B, which will be played in the Dominican Republic at the Estadio Panamericano stadium. 58 Year Old Injured In Collision

A 58 year old Smith’s parish man was injured after the rental bike he was riding was involved in a collision with a car yesterday [June 27] on South Road. Full Police Statement: Around 11pm on Monday, police attended a reported road traffic collision resulting in injury on South Road in Smith’s parish in the vicinity of John Smith’s Bay. Blackburn Wins Silver, Sets Record

Lisa Blackburn’s time of 2:40.01 in the 200m breastroke not only earned her a Silver Medal at the 2011 Caribbean Championships, but also shattered Jenny Smatt’s 1992 record.
